What is Redberry Bible Camp?

We are an Mennonite Brethren Saskatchewan Camp located 90 km NW of Saskatoon. Our programs are based on Jesus Christ’s command to make disciples. Through summer programing and staff development, we aim to share God’s love, life, and forgiveness through the Good News of Jesus. Our Mission Statement is as follows; “To communicate the Good News of Jesus Christ through the uniqueness of a camp experience. As a camp we follow the Saskatchewan Conference of Mennonite Brethren Churches Confession of Faith. To see this Confession of Faith Click Here.

Redberry’s History


Redberry Bible Camp was established in 1943 and was first known as Sand Beach Bible Camp on Lake Mistawasis. The first summer of Sand Beach Bible Camp saw 75 campers. In 1952 the camp was moved to its current location at Redberry Lake and its name was changed to Redberry Bible Camp. That year, Redberry served 250 campers. In 1975, Redberry had its first full time Director in Reuben Andres, father to the current Executive Director Wendell Andres. Redberry Bible Camp has changed, and grown, a lot since 1943. The camp now has around 1,100 campers during the summer months.
